Recently, I saw a friend of mine post about Facetory, which is a subscription box for Korean sheet masks. I figure I would give it a try and opted for the $15/month package. I've become so bored with regular subscription boxes (aside from Scratch Monthy Mani of course!) that I'm elated to find this and have some exciting mail each month.
The above photo shows the masks I received in my January box.
❖ Nuca Hydro Superjelly Aqua Coral Mask
❖ MSbyN Deep Aqua System Mask
❖ Frienvita Re-New Filtering Caviar Vita B Mask
❖ 23 Years Old Badecasil Dermaseal Mask
❖ A by Bom Ultra Perfect Cream Mask
❖ Point de mire Snow Cooling & Lifting Mask
❖ Dr. Jart+ Vital Hydra Solution Mask
My favorites are absolutely the Frienvita Caviar Mask and the Dr. Jart+ Vital Hydra. The Frienvita made my skin feel so soft, while the Dr. Jart+ made my skin feel moisturized. Another fun one was the Point de mire Snow Cooling & Lifting Mask — putting it on sort of felt like jumping in a cold swimming pool.
